Job Overview

Job purpose

To carry out routine maintenance and respond to breakdowns as directed by the Maintenance Manager or Site Manager, with specific responsibility for ELV and LV electrical systems and associated equipment.

 

Please note: Candidates must be willing to go through the DV Clearance process. Before this clearance is confirm they will be unable to start within the role.

Applying candidates must be a holder of a British Passport, otherwise the clearance will not pass.

Responsibilities

  • Offer a prompt and professional response to the Client to ensure the building systems and plan remain in full operation
  • Responsible for carrying out electrical installation work, PAT Testing and assisting with electrical safety testing
  • Undertake planned and reactive works
  • Provide support to the Maintenance Manager
  • Undertake other duties over and above those required of this role, within reason, as directed by the Maintenance Manager or Site Manager
  • Partake in the Out-of-Hours on call service rota (1 in 3)
  • Respond to building management system alarms, and effect emergency repairs as needed.
  • Issue and ensure appropriate controls within the permit to work systems.
  • Ensure that suitable spares are available to carry out repairs and maintenance of the above plant.
  • Ensure that comprehensive maintenance records are kept in the form of “MAXIMO” task sheets.
  • Ensure that method statements and risk assessments are prepared for all tasks carried out to ensure safe working practices.
  • Ensure that engineering subcontractors are appropriately supervised and comply with contractual commitments.
  • To develop a good working relationship with all Mitie staff and client's staff.
  • Ensure the provision of a safe and healthy working environment, and ensure compliance with all company policies and procedures, as well as client site policies, procedures and working arrangements as required.
  • Ensure a professional image of Mitie is presented to clients and visitors and ensure excellence in customer service is delivered and always promoted.
  • Ensure that professional and technical skills are maintained at all times.

Knowledge and experience (Essential)

  • Working to planned preventative maintenance regimes.
  • Fault finding on basic electrical circuits.
  • Knowledge of lone working requirements.
  • Risk Assessment trained.
  • Experience or general building management systems.
  • Installation of electrical services.
  • Electrical testing to BS7671.
  •  

Essential qualifications :-

  • AM2 (or equivalent time served electrical qualification).
  • Knowledge/experience of working to BS7671
  • C&G 2391 or equivalent experience of electrical testing and inspection#.
  •  

Desirable qualifications :-

  • 17th/18th Edition Regulations
  • C&G 2330, 2360,2365 or any other electrical based qualifications.
  • GCSE Maths & English or equivalent.
